    This is my second time in two days to come back and get the Best Breakfast Burrito I have found in the surrounding communities. I am from SoCal and they have more Mexican Food places than Seattle has Starbucks so when you can get a large, tasty, Breakfast Burrito and they modified it with no meat and with egg whites I was smitten. And then I went to the salsa bar it got even better. They had a Pico de gallo that was the best. So fresh, light on tomato, almost salad like. While waiting I admired how clean the tables, chairs and floors were as the tortillas were being hand made right off the grill. The senorita so meticulously balled up the dough and made each one perfectly and grilled and turned them over so they were perfect for taste, texture and warmth. If food is your love then the tortilla senorita is the beginning of your aroma for romance. Alas, perhaps an once upon a time food story will start with a unexpected visit to El Rincosito.

    El Rinconsito here in Puyallup is deliciously Amazing! It's become my Sunday go-to for their Pollo Asado. They do a great dark sear on the chicken so it's fork-tender on the inside. I have to fight my kitty Leo for it ‍. Rice is always nice and fluffy. Yesenia and Ingrid taking orders at the counter are always friendly and attentive. Luis working the grill - I've never seen anyone work meat on and off the grill so fast! Sundays are busy, so they know the importance of efficiency. Helena - your managers have hired and trained a great staff - which I know takes a lot of effort and follow-up. Great Job! And Leo agrees - he gives Puyallup El Rinconsito 4 Paws Up!! - Michelle W, Puyallup WA

    I was in the Puyallup area and decided to patronize this Mexican restaurant which was featured by…read moreseattlefoodie Steven Nguyen on KING 5 news. Bottom Line Up Front...One star for the cleanliness, easy parking and the thoughtful decor. Steven missed on this one big time. The fact that they didn't have customers when he visited them could have been one of three issues (food quality, poor service, inflated prices). In my case, it was all 3. There were older white folks who saw Steven's article and did mention it to the wait staff. Some of those tables received chips and salsa, most didn't, not sure what goes into their criteria for who gets it and who doesn't. I chitchatted with the wait staff and asked them their specials and what they would want me to tell the Yelpers about them. They wanted me to give the community my honest opinion and said their best sellers are the Quesabirria and ramen (what what?) . Well we decided on neither of those and ordered the $17.95 Chicken Enchilada mole and the $12.90 Chicken Mulitas (each $6.45, staff did not ask if I wanted one or two). To be brutally honest...the Enchiladas were "lean" & dreadful. The mole sauce tasted like mud. The rice and beans was barely palatable (La Preferida from Safeway might have been better!). The Mulitas was ok but not something that I would miss. The red and green salsa from those plastic bottles was salty...as were all of the dishes...saltier... The plates were small, the price tag was hefty, paid extra for mole sauce (this was NOT a side order but something that is supposed to be the core dish sauce), extra for credit card use (3%). Nickel and diming...what next...clean your own table... quarter for restroom use! Of course, none of these upcharges were mentioned or listed anywhere that I could see... Service was just ok...they didn't talk about any specials or drinks...so we didn't order one. And the biggest kicker...no complimentary chips and salsa unlike those other hardworking Mexican joints awaiting your business. There was no hook; all sinker...Somehow, they think of themselves as "Cactus" but lack the basics of competing for your business. I ended up with an upset stomach later that evening. Don't take my word only...read the other reviewers observations in a bit more detail while ignoring the stars and judge for yourself. Sorry if my review sounds too brutal, which I hate to do knowing how hard it is to run a restaurant. I greatly respect the hard working folks in the restaurant industry. I wish they seriously consider their customers' feedback and make some changes for the better.
